To keep the same standard of living as $100,000 in Cleveland, OH, you'd need about $102,437 in Albuquerque, NM (+$2,437).

Livability — Cleveland, OH: 71 · Albuquerque, NM: 60 (0–100).

What your home budget buys

A $500,000 home budget gets you about 3,270 sqft in Cleveland vs 2,621 sqft in Albuquerque ($153 vs $191 per sqft).
